    Netflix Pulls Chris D’Elia, Bryan Callen Prank Show

    Netflix has scrapped plans for a non-scripted prank show featuring comedians Chris D’Elia (“Undateable”) and Bryan Callen following accusations of sexual misconduct against D’Elia. Multiple woman last month accused D’Elia of sexually harassing them, including when they were underage. D’Elia denied all accusations, saying he “never knowingly pursued” underage women and that all his relationships have […]

    Netflix Cancels Turkish Drama ‘If Only’ Censorship of Gay Character 

    Netflix has decided not to move forward on production of planned Turkish drama “If Only” because of the government censorship of a gay character in the script. The series was to have been produced by Turkish production company Ay Yapim and has been described in promotional materials as the story of Reyhan, an unhappily married mother […]

    CBS and NAACP Ink Multi-Year Content Deal

    CBS TV Studios and the National Association for the Advancement of Colored People (NAACP) have announced a multi-year deal to develop and produce scripted, unscripted and documentary content for linear and streaming platforms. Under the deal, creative leaders from CBS TV Studios will work with the civil rights group to establish a dedicated team of executives and […]

    Netflix Orders Jessica Watson Biopic ‘True Spirit’

    Netflix has greenlit a feature film focused on Jessica Watson, who, in 2009, became the youngest person to sail solo, non-stop and unassisted around the world. The film will be adapted and directed by Sarah Spillane and produced by Debra Martin Chase and Sunstar Entertainment Spillane and Cathy Randall will write the feature, with Shahen Mekertichian […]
